Amanda Wrigley1 editions

Greece on Air' offers a discussion of the fascinating history of public engagements thought via the BBC Radio, from the birth of domestic broadcasting in the 1920s up to the 1960s. The range of programmes broadcast in this period includes engagements with ideas from and about ancient Greece in twentieth-century Britain. Wrigley draws on the vast amount of evidence that exists in the written archives to develop a full understanding of the role of the radio medium in public engagements with ancient Greece in twentieth-century Britain.
